Attorney Ben Crump Files Lawsuit on Behalf of User of Chemical Hair Straightening Products

 

October 27, 2022

Some chemicals have been affecting women's hair during processing for years

Researchers have discovered that hair products used predominately by Black women are likely to contain hazardous chemicals with endocrine-disrupting

and carcinogenic properties. Armed with that information and research by the Journal of the National Cancer Institute, civil rights attorney Ben Crump

joined forces with lawyer Diandra "Fu" Debrosse Zimmermann to file a lawsuit against beauty products giant L' Oréal USA.

Crump and Zimmermann filed the suit on behalf of Jenny Mitchell, a woman with no family history of cancer but who received a uterine cancer diagnosis
